InfoObject Naming ConventionsLocate this document in the navigation structure

Use

As is the case for other objects in BW, the customer namespace A-Z is also reserved for InfoObjects.

When you create an InfoObject, the name you give it has to begin with a letter. BW Content InfoObjects start with 0.

Integration

If you change an InfoObject in the SAP namespace, your modified InfoObject is not overwritten immediately when you install a new release, and your changes remain in place for the time being.

BW Content InfoObjects are initially delivered in the D version. If you use the BW Content InfoObject, it is activated. If you change the activated InfoObject, a new M version is generated. When this M version is activated, it overwrites the previous active version.

Caution

Keep in mind that when you are determining naming conventions for InfoObjects, the length of an InfoObject is restricted to 60 characters. Included here is the concatenated value if other characteristics are compounded to other InfoObjects. See also Tab Page: Compounding.
